Taxonomic Classification

Rank Large False Serotine Small Plume
Kingdom same Animalia (Animals) Animalia (Animals)
Phylum Chordata (Chordates) Arthropoda (Arthropods)
Class Mammalia (Mammals) Insecta (Insects)
Order Chiroptera (Bats) Lepidoptera (Butterflies & Moths)
Family Vespertilionidae Pterophoridae
Genus Hesperoptenus Oxyptilus
Species Hesperoptenus tomesi Oxyptilus parvidactyla

Evolutionary Relationship

Large False Serotine and Small Plume share a common ancestor at the Kingdom level: Animalia. (Animals)

Small Plume

Habitat

Inhabits montane grasslands and shrublands and Mediterranean forests and woodlands within the Palearctic biogeographic realm.

Range

Widely distributed across Africa (Morocco), Asia (6 countries), and Europe (33 countries).
